Violation Count vs. the National Corpus

Basin Water Sources Inc has 32 recorded EPA violations, 44% of the 29,740 public water systems serving 500+ people nationwide carry fewer, and 55% carry more. 9% of this system's own violations are health-based (3 of 32), and it ranks #18,206 of 29,740 by population served among that same cohort.
